Random House Webster's College Dictionary

yareyɛər or, esp. for 1,2 , yɑr(adj.)yar•er, yar•est.

  1. quick; agile; lively.

  2. (of a ship) quick to the helm; easily handled or maneuvered.

    Category: Nautical, Navy

  3. Archaic. ready; prepared. nimble; quick.

    Ref: Also, yar (for defs. 1,2 ).

Origin of yare:

bef. 900; ME; OE gearu, gearo=ge-y - +earu ready; c. OS, OHG garo ready

yare′ly(adv.)
